from __future__ import annotations
from collections.abc import Generator
from fastapi import HTTPException, Request, status
from sqlalchemy import Engine, create_engine, event, text
from sqlalchemy.pool import StaticPool
from sqlalchemy.orm import Session, declarative_base, sessionmaker
from srht_contrib.config import Settings
Base = declarative_base()
def make_engine(settings: Settings) -> Engine:
connect_args = {}
if settings.database_url.startswith("sqlite"):
connect_args = {
"check_same_thread": False,
"timeout": settings.sqlite_busy_timeout_seconds,
}
engine_kwargs = {"future": True, "connect_args": connect_args}
if settings.database_url in {"sqlite://", "sqlite:///:memory:"}:
engine_kwargs["poolclass"] = StaticPool
engine = create_engine(settings.database_url, **engine_kwargs)
if settings.database_url.startswith("sqlite"):
@event.listens_for(engine, "connect")
def _configure_sqlite(dbapi_connection, connection_record) -> None: # type: ignore[unused-ignore]
cursor = dbapi_connection.cursor()
cursor.execute(f"PRAGMA busy_timeout = {int(settings.sqlite_busy_timeout_seconds * 1000)}")
if settings.database_url not in {"sqlite://", "sqlite:///:memory:"}:
cursor.execute("PRAGMA journal_mode = WAL")
cursor.execute("PRAGMA synchronous = NORMAL")
cursor.close()
return engine
def make_session_factory(settings: Settings) -> sessionmaker[Session]:
engine = make_engine(settings)
return sessionmaker(bind=engine, autoflush=False, autocommit=False, expire_on_commit=False)
def validate_db(bind: Engine) -> None:
with bind.connect() as connection:
connection.execute(text("SELECT 1"))
def get_db() -> Generator[Session, None, None]:
raise RuntimeError("Use get_db(request) dependency injection with a Request parameter.")
def get_session_factory(request: Request) -> sessionmaker[Session]:
session_factory = getattr(request.app.state, "session_factory", None)
if session_factory is None:
raise HTTPException(status_code=status.HTTP_500_INTERNAL_SERVER_ERROR, detail="Database not configured.")
return session_factory
def get_db_session(request: Request) -> Generator[Session, None, None]:
session_factory = get_session_factory(request)
db = session_factory()
try:
yield db
finally:
db.close()
